| Census |
4 Apr 1940 |
3721 Council Crest, Madison, Dane County, Wisconsin [5] |
- Phillip Falk, owned home worth $12,000, Head, Male, White, 42, Married, completed 7 years college, born in Wisconsin, residence 1 April 1935 was Madison, Wisconsin, Superintendent of Schools, City of Madison, wages earned in 1939 - $5000
Ethel Falk, Wife, Female, White, 43, Married, completed 4 years college, born in Wisconsin, residence 1 April 1935 was Lake Mills, Wisconsin

| WW2 Draft |
14 Feb 1942 |
3721 Council Crest, Madison, Dane County, Wisconsin [6] |
- Philip Hadley Falk, 3721 Council Crest, Madison, Dane, Wis, born 13 Jun 1897 in Dane, Wisconsin, registered for the draft. He was employed by the Madison Board of Education. The person who would always know his address was his wife, Ethel Mabie Falk, at the same address. He was White, 5' 10", 168 pounds, had blue eyes, gray hair, and a light complexion.
